Abstract

The skill of drawing patterns in different ways is one of the skills that require the use of the demonstration strategy due to the accuracy of this skill and its importance for the clothing industry. With the global conditions and the crisis that countries of the world are going through in the time of Corona pandemic, it is difficult to provide students with continuous training and practical demonstration inside traditional classrooms. Therefore, it is necessary to utilize teaching methods that would enable the students to train continuously and have direct and quick feedback. It was also necessary to introduce modern technological means, such as the Edmodo learning platform, which provides an integrated learning environment, and through which the study needs of students can be provided to achieve the desired goals. Thus, the current research aimed to create the Edmodo learning platform as a modern method to teach the drawing of Aldrich pattern for children, and measure its effectiveness in developing the knowledge and skills of students in drawing the Aldrich pattern for children, as well as identify the views of the students towards Edmodo. The significance of the present research lies in that it is an objective response to the education requirements at the present time through the use of the Edmodo learning platform as one of the free e-learning models that can be employed in teaching clothing and textile courses.
